The answer is -15. Here are the sign rules to multiplication. If you multiply two numbers with the same sign, the result will be positive. If you multiply two numbers with opposite signs, the result will be negative.

When multiplying two negative numbers you multiply as you would with regular positive numbers the product will ALWAYS be positive. Example: -3 x -3 = 9

If you multiply a negative number with a positive number, the result will be negative. If you multiply two negatives, the result will be positive.
